3.0 out of 5 stars Another Comic Adventure, May 1, 2009
By Acute Observer (Jersey Shore USA) - See all my reviews
(TOP 1000 REVIEWER)   
This review is from: Blondie 28: Beware of Blondie [VHS] (VHS Tape)
The film begins in their living room where Cookie is practicing on the piano. Dagwood smokes a cigar. What did it cost? Dagwood does his taxes. [Why is Dagwood so confused over numbers?] Garbage is collected early in the morning. "Give me strength." Dagwood is tired the next morning. [Is this funny?] A business client arrives from Toby Enterprises. They visit the site and go to lunch. Will people gossip? Would a business executive carry a lunchbox? [No, that's what an attaché case is for.] Will Dagwood miss his bus? "It's a real name." Miss Clifton visits again about the contract. Another restaurant for lunch. There are jokes about a foreign language. Dagwood learns why he can't get that item. That contract is in her hotel room. Blondie and the kids drop by and learn that Dagwood is out to lunch, again.

Has Dagwood fallen for an old scam? [Do they check the background of prospective clients?] Now Dagwood is in trouble with Blondie. The next morning Dagwood gets the truth about the contract. What can he do? Dagwood dreams of his fate. A call from J. C. Dithers brings news. But Dagwood must mail his tax return immediately and runs out the front door at night? Who will he meet and surprise?

This was the end of the movie series. Did Arthur Lake get arrested for smoking weed and the scandal ended the series? Or was the appeal of this series declining along with movie audiences? Could it compete with the shows on broadcast TV? [Did Fran Drescher copy her laugh from Dagwood?]
